Cochran is 105% larger than Dublin. Dublin earns more, with a median household income $54,357 higher.
COCHRANDUBLINDIFFERENCE
Total population4,9862,436+105% vs Dublin
Population density1,0644,178−3,114
Population growth-2.4%0.9%−3.3 pts
Median age28.642.2−13.6
Male46.5%43.3%+3.3 pts
Female53.5%56.7%−3.3 pts
Foreign-born1.9%4.4%−2.6 pts
White, non-Hispanic43.3%80.5%−37.2 pts
Black48.0%0.2%+47.8 pts
Hispanic / Latino5.4%11.5%−6.2 pts
Asian2.1%0.5%+1.6 pts
Other1.2%7.3%−6.1 pts
Median household income$33,456$87,813−$54,357
Per capita income$21,630$47,312−$25,682
Poverty rate32.1%10.0%+22.1 pts
Income inequality (Gini)0.6020.391+0.2
Bachelor's degree or higher22.0%37.8%−15.8 pts
Graduate degree5.9%6.9%−1.0 pts
Unemployment rate12.2%2.5%+9.6 pts
Labor force participation49.7%72.6%−22.9 pts
Median home value$112,800$395,800−$283,000
Median gross rent$766$1,440−$674
Owner-occupied57.8%63.9%−6.1 pts
Housing vacancy rate17.0%5.5%+11.5 pts
Rent-burdened households51.9%53.0%−1.1 pts
Average commute23.428.4−4.9
Worked from home5.8%14.2%−8.3 pts
Public transit to work0.4%0.0%+0.4 pts
Uninsured9.9%5.8%+4.1 pts
